The keynote address delivered by General Secretary and State President To Lam at the 23rd Shangri-La Dialogue has continued to attract attention from international media and observers. Many have highly appreciated his messages regarding the central role of the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N), as well as the need for countries to engage in dialogue and cooperation to maintain peace and stability amid intensifying geopolitical competition.

According to the Vietnam News Agency (VNA) correspondent in Jakarta, Indonesia’s Antara News Agency and Tempo newspaper on May 30 published articles covering General Secretary and President To Lam’s keynote speech at the opening session of the 2026 Shangri-La Dialogue.

The articles cited the Vietnamese leader’s assessment that the Asia-Pacific region shares common interests in peace, connectivity, and development, while also possessing extensive experience in multi-layered cooperation.

General Secretary and President To Lam also emphasized that ASEAN has sufficient motivation and determination to prevent competition from turning into confrontation, to ensure that connectivity routes do not become lines of division, and to prevent one country’s security from becoming another country’s insecurity.

According to the reports, the Vietnamese leader noted that ASEAN’s centrality neither emerges naturally nor sustains itself automatically. ASEAN can only maintain this role through unity, strategic autonomy, and the capacity to shape a common agenda.

Indonesian media paid particular attention to General Secretary and President To Lam’s message that the Asia-Pacific region welcomes a transparent and responsible presence that respects international law and contributes to reducing tensions and strengthening trust among nations.

Observers believe that these remarks reflect Vietnam’s consistent position of promoting multilateralism, upholding ASEAN’s role, and emphasizing the importance of dialogue and cooperation in addressing regional and global security challenges.

Against the backdrop of an increasingly complex global geopolitical environment, the messages of ASEAN unity, strategic autonomy, and confidence-building are regarded as highly relevant and practical. They also help affirm Vietnam’s increasingly active role in regional and international affairs.
